What is Pressure?
Pressure is the force applied perpendicular to a surface per unit area: P = F / A. The SI unit is the pascal (Pa), equal to one newton per square metre (1 Pa = 1 N/m²). Practical applications use larger units: the bar (1 bar = 100,000 Pa, close to standard atmospheric pressure), atmosphere (atm) (1 atm = 101,325 Pa), and psi (pounds per square inch, used in the US for tire and gas pressures). Blood pressure is measured in mmHg (millimetres of mercury), also called torr.
What is Standard Atmosphere?
The standard atmosphere (symbol: atm) is a non-SI unit of pressure defined as exactly 101,325 pascals. It represents the average atmospheric pressure at sea level under standard conditions and is widely used in chemistry, physics, meteorology, and engineering. The standard atmosphere provides a convenient reference for pressure measurements and scientific calculations. Additional information is available in the standard atmosphere reference.
One standard atmosphere is equal to 101,325 pascals, 1.01325 bars, 101.325 kilopascals, 14.6959 pounds per square inch, and 760 millimeters of mercury. The standard atmosphere is one of the most important reference units in science and engineering.
What is Gram-force per Square Meter?
The gram-force per square meter (symbol: gf/m²) is a non-SI unit of pressure representing the pressure exerted by one gram-force acting on an area of one square meter. It is used mainly in historical engineering references and educational examples, while SI units such as the pascal are preferred in modern practice. The unit is based on the gram-force.
One gram-force per square meter is equal to 0.00980665 pascal, 0.00000980665 kilopascal, 9.80665×10-8 bar, 0.00000142233 psi, and 9.67841×10-8 standard atmosphere. The unit is rarely used today outside specialized references.
